Project Manager Role at GPAC

The Project Manager provides the overall leadership for the execution of successful outcomes on commercial/light industrial projects. The Project Manager leads the project team with a focus on the customer, utilizing open communication, setting clear direction, and establishing high levels of expectations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with Estimating during the Preconstruction Phase to ensure accurate project planning.
  • Read and Interpret Construction Plans and Specifications to identify potential project risks and opportunities.
  • Mentor less experienced Project Management staff on the daily duties required to manage a construction project effectively, ensuring knowledge transfer and skill development.
  • Work with your Team's existing Owners, Architects, Engineers, and Subcontractors to establish long-term relationships to identify and obtain future project opportunities, driving business growth and expansion.
  • Oversee the Subcontractor and Vendor procurement by supervising the completion of the buyout, scope of work review, contract writing, insurance, bonding reviews, etc., ensuring compliance with company policies and industry standards.
  • Guide the research and recommendation of resolutions to drawing interpretation problems, conflicts, and errors, promoting a culture of continuous improvement.
  • Manage the Team that processes all Submittals, RFI's, Change Order Proposals, Owner Billings, Time Sheet Management, Subcontractor/Vendor Billings, Monthly Reports, etc., ensuring timely and accurate project documentation.
  • Ensure the preparation of timely Owner Billings via verifying work-in-place quantities/billings from Subcontractors and Suppliers, maintaining a high level of customer satisfaction.
  • Verify the production of accurate monthly cost projections, which forecast total estimated costs at completion, enabling informed business decisions.
  • Oversight of creating and monitoring Project Schedules and production of progress updates, ensuring project deliverables are met.

Requirements:

  • Broad knowledge of building systems and construction methods, with a focus on industry best practices.
  • Strong financial management skills and the ability to independently manage all aspects of a project from start to finish, ensuring fiscal responsibility and accountability.
